Wash and thoroughly dry the apples. Insert a stick into the top of the apples and set aside.
Prepare a baking sheet with wax paper, sprayed with cooking spray. Set aside.
In a small saucepan, mix the sugar, corn syrup and water and attach the candy thermometer to the side of the pan, ensuring that the bottom reaches the mixture.
Cook the mixture over medium heat, until the candy thermometer reaches 300 degrees.
Remove the pan from heat and stir in red food coloring until desired color is reached.
Dip each apple into the melted sugars, allowing access to drip off. Dip each apple 2-3 times before setting them on the sprayed wax paper to set.
